As part of the Trump administration’s push to expand U.S. energy production,
federal officials will review and consider redrawing the boundaries of national monuments
created under previous presidents to protect unique landscapes and cultural resources.

The review
— laid out in a Monday order from new Interior Secretary Doug Burgum
— is raising alarms among conservation groups concerned that Donald Trump will shrink
or eliminate monuments established by his predecessors,
including Democrat Joe Biden.

Burgum gave agency officials until Feb. 18 to submit plans on how to comply with his order.

Among the sites most at risk are
Bears Ears
and Grand Staircase-Escalante National Monuments in Utah,
where state officials fought against their creation.

Grand Staircase-Escalante holds large coal reserves,
and the Bears Ears area has uranium.

Hello EU people:

There is an EU citizen petition to ban the use of "conversion therapy" on LGBTQ+ folks (i.e., trying to de-LGBTQ us— a process often described as "torture"). If you're interested, you can sign it here:

eci.ec.europa.eu/043/public/#/…

Please especially take note if you are a national of Spain, Slovenia, Belgium, or the Netherlands; the petition needs about 5x as many votes as it has now, but also needs to hit a threshold in four additional countries, and those are the four closest.
